Postmortem fragment: Stale-cache bug in Fernwick's pricing layer. The edge cache on Tollgate kept serving quotes for 40 minutes past TTL because the invalidation fanout silently dropped messages when the broker restarted. Fix shipped: invalidation now acks per-shard, and cache reads reject entries older than 10 minutes regardless of TTL. Before approving the release, confirm the canary on the Harwick cluster shows zero stale reads over a full hour. The validating build token appears below this line.

trace token, fafog-kageg: htk4_98e6

TURN-208: Gatevale turnstile counters at the Merrow Field pilot double-count when a rotation reverses mid-cycle. Attendance totals drift roughly 2% high per event. The debounce window fix is implemented, reviewed by Ilsa, and soak-tested across two simulated match days without drift. Ready for your cut; the candidate build is identified below.

trace token, tagag-tafog: htk6_5ed18c

MEMO — Harlowe Fabrication
To: All Branch Managers
From: D. Vexley, Operations

Quick update on the Tarnwick plant question. After months of back-and-forth, we've decided to add a third shift rather than build the annex at Pellam Ridge. It's cheaper, faster, and keeps the crews we've already trained. Expect revised intake quotas from your regional leads within two weeks. Don't commit to new delivery promises until those land. Fuller rationale and forward plans are set out in the confidential note below.

management briefing: The renewal with Quenathox Group closes at $10 million a year, 20 percent below the last contract. Project Ulawyn slips by two quarters because of the supplier delay.